On November 30th, 2025, the arrest of Israel Salgado-Miron, age 39, was announced by Ocean County Prosecutor Bradley D. Billhimer. Israel Salgado-Miron was charged with Aggravated Arson and two counts of Arson. The arrest and charges against Israel Salgado-Miron were a result of an investigation handled by the Ocean County Prosecutor’s Office Major Crime Unit-Arson Squad, Ocean County Sheriff’s Office Crime Scene Investigation Unit, Lakewood Township Police Department Detective Bureau, and Ocean County Fire Marshal’s Office.
According to the Ocean County Prosecutor’s Office, at approximately 10:30 p.m. on November 29th, 2025, a fire was responded to at a building on East Eight Street in Lakewood, New Jersey. First responders located the fire in the basement window well of the building, shortly after two more bush fires in the area were discovered. The three fires were tended to by firefighters and an investigation was promptly launched into the incidents. The window fire in the building on East Eight Street was determined to be caused by an open flame in conjunction with combustible materials. The two bush fires were determined to be incendiary, caused with a hot set and jackpot of fuel. Detectives had identified Israel Salgado-Miron to be the individual allegedly responsible for starting the fires.
The Ocean County Prosecutor’s Office stated that the charges against Israel Salgado-Miron are merely accusations, and the defendant is presumed innocent unless proven guilty beyond a reasonable doubt in a court of law.
